Hope - this project was a great experience for me. The script grew out of a school assignment, but it became very special for me at that time. Because the idea I put there seemed very important to me, I wanted to convey it to people through this film. There were a lot of problems with casting, the actors of which I initially thought to invite to the project, were either ill or took off for some other reason. But it all turned out for the best, because in the end the film got the best actors I could find for this job. They agreed to shoot literally "for food", simply because they liked the script. I am still infinitely grateful to them, and to the whole team who believed in this film and decided to spend their resources on its creation! Despite the lack of funds and time, we still took it off!

An infantile web designer surrounded by modern gadgets finds himself locked in an apartment without electricity. Finding a way to survive the blackout, he recalls a forgotten childhood dream. But will he stay true to himself when the electricity returns?

The eccentric, noisy, choleric journalist Khrystyna is used to relying on herself and realizing her spiritual needs in her pet Michelle. Therefore, when her father comes to visit her indefinitely to treat her leg, it becomes for the girl a real challenge. The editor of the news release gives Christina the task for the evening issue to collect a story about the weather. Girl is doing it at home, but it seems that her father is doing everything to thwart her plans to write a story in time. The girl from the heart runs away from home to the nearest cafe to write a story there. And in the evening she is walking around the city for a long time because she doesn't want to return home. After all, when she comes to the apartment, there are two surprises for her, which change this evening and the relationship between Khrystyna and her father.

Nina has been dancing ballet since her childhood. The merciless drill of her mother, who is her ballet teacher, taught Nina always to keep a stiff upper lip. She can only imagine the whirl of emotions in her head. Nina can't show compassion to herself or her mother and little ballet student. Does self-pity lie beyond the pale, and how to learn it?
